A look back at the top shots from the SA Open, where Graeme Storm claimed a dramatic victory

From hole-out eagles to a stunning hole-in-one, we look back at the shots of the week from the BMW SA Open, where Graeme Storm lifted the trophy.

The tournament saw a dramatic finale at Glendower GC, as Storm upstaged world No 2 Rory McIlroy in a play-off to claim a first European Tour victory in a decade.

McIlroy was in contention throughout the week and bolstered his chances of a winning start to 2017 when he holed from the fairway during his third round.

Jordan Smith claimed a career-best third spot, with the Englishman temporarily moving top of the leaderboard on the final day following an incredible second shot at the par-five 15th.

Smith almost went inches away from a hole-in-one on the opening day, while home favourite Jaco Van Zyl went one better at the par-three 17th on Friday to post the second ace of the season.

Elsewhere, Mikko Korhonen experienced a moment of horror when he pitched in to the cup – only for his ball to jump back out a few inches from the flag!
